AMITA Health has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 775 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The AMITA Health employ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Healthcare industry (3.4 stars).

Pros

Flexible schedule, because there is no other staff, you can pick whenever you want to work.

Cons

Long term employee writing. This place is NOT what it used to be. Poor pay. What you get walking in the door you can expect to stay at for a long time. Minimal raises that don't cover the cost of living. If you get ill or injured on the job good luck trying to get any compensation without a fight. Management will not support you. Management also is good at hiring staff. They have to be since the turnover rate is so high. Also, you should be willing to compromise your ethics and morals because you will be asked to do things that fly in the face of common sense and you know are not good for patient care. However, they do make the numbers for the hospital " look good" on paper. Also expect to never have a good day at work. The second the census drops you will be sent home. Because you will be working with mostly contract nurses, YOU will be the one sent home, as the contract nurses CAN'T be sent home. Don't expect a flex up in staffing when its busy. The plan for this place when its busy is..... They have NO plan. Take your shiny sign on bonus if you get a job here, but you have been warned.
